Sol. Hand hygiene is considered the most essential and effective method for preventing infections in healthcare settings. It helps stop the transmission of microorganisms from person to person or from contaminated surfaces.
Explanation of each option: • (a) Ventilation – While proper airflow reduces airborne infections, it is a supportive measure and not a direct personal precaution. • (b) Hand hygiene – Correct. Regular hand washing or sanitization is the most critical step in infection prevention across all healthcare settings. • (c) Disinfection – Refers to cleaning instruments or surfaces, not a universal personal technique applicable in all situations. • (d) Use of masks – Important for preventing respiratory transmission, but hand hygiene remains the core universal technique for all types of infections.
